Website. official site. The Naismith College Player of the Year is an annual basketball award given by the Atlanta Tipoff Club to the top men's and women's collegiate basketball players. This article lists U.S. men's college basketball national player of the year awards. Several organizations sponsor an award for the nation's top player. Twenty-nine times since there’s been six player of the year awards, has a single player won each award. These players are considered the consensus national player of the year.
